Title: The West Magazine - True Stories of the Old West, December 1969 - the Guns of Fred Sutton
Description: USA: Maverick Publications Inc, 1969. First Edition. Paperback. 74 pages. Features: Man on a Steer - Nate Higgins and his wife Lucy ride steers - article with photos; Western Gunfight in Hula Hula Land - The Parker Ranch; Too Tough to Kill - Texas Ranger Henry Mims; That Bloody Fence-Cutting War - Lev (L.P.) Baugh of Texas; Star-Crossed Orphans of the Trail - weddings along the Oregon Trail; Peg Legs and Poultices - The Good Samaritan School of Nursing; Lawman Cape Willingham and the Taming of the Panhandle - involves John Adair and Charles Goodnight; The Guns of Fred Sutton - article and photos of his incredible collection; The Man Who Discovered a Mystery - Pierre Gaultier De Varennes, Sieur de la Verendreye.
